There is a critical shortage of qualified AMSA licensed compass adjusters in Australia to meet the demand required by the Navigation Act and the various State legislations. Marine Order Part 21 has been revised. To become an AMSA Licensed Compass Adjuster you are required to meet section 14.4.2 of Marine Order Part 21. You are not required to hold any maritime qualifications.

14.4.2 If the Manager, Ship Operations and Qualifications, is satisfied that a person who has made application under 14.4.1: (a) Has successfully completed a course, approved by the Manager, Ship Operations and Qualifications, on adjustment of compasses; and (b) Has assisted in adjusting the compasses of at least 12 ships during the previous three years, The Manager, Ship Operations and Qualifications, is to issue that person with a Licence as Compass Adjuster. The course meets sub section (a) of 14.4.1 of Marine Order Part 21.
